The Gift and the Curse

In the dark future of the 41st millennium, psykers are humans born with the ability to tap into the immaterial realm known as the Warp. While these powers make them invaluable to the Imperium, they also make them dangerous and feared.

The Black Ships

Every day, thousands of psykers manifest their powers across the Imperium. The Black Ships of the Adeptus Astra Telepathica travel from world to world, collecting these individuals before they can cause catastrophe. Many become sanctioned psykers serving the Imperium, while others feed the insatiable hunger of the Golden Throne...

The Soul Binding

Those psykers deemed useful to the Imperium undergo the Soul Binding ritual, where they gaze upon a fraction of the Emperor's radiance. This painful process either kills them, drives them insane, or renders them blind—but also helps protect them from daemonic possession and gives them greater control over their abilities.

Psychic Disciplines

Telepathy

The art of mind reading, mental manipulation, and psychic communication across vast distances.

Telekinesis

The ability to move objects with the power of the mind, create psychic barriers, and even crush enemies.

Pyromancy

The manipulation of warp energies to create and control devastating flames that burn both body and soul.

Divination

The ability to glimpse the strands of fate, predict enemy movements, and see possible futures.

The Many Faces of Psychic Power

The Imperium classifies psykers by their power, control, and allegiance. Learn about the different types of these extraordinary individuals.

Sanctioned Imperial Psykers

These are psykers who have been officially approved by the Imperium and have undergone the Soul Binding ritual with the Emperor. They serve in various Imperial institutions including the Astra Telepathica and Imperial Guard.

Their psychic signatures are characterized by controlled blue-green energy manifestations and regulated power outputs.

Librarian Space Marines

Elite psychic warriors of the Adeptus Astartes, Librarians are among the most disciplined and powerful psykers in the Imperium. Their training allows them to harness warp energy with precision while resisting corruption.

Their psychic manifestations often appear as deep blue energy constructs, representing their unwavering loyalty to the Emperor.

Untrained Wild Talents

Discovered throughout Imperial worlds, these individuals manifest psychic abilities without training or control. They are highly dangerous to themselves and others, often becoming gateways for demonic possession.

Their unstable powers manifest as vibrant, erratic energy bursts that can be devastating and unpredictable.

Chaos Sorcerers

Having given themselves to the Ruinous Powers, Chaos Sorcerers embrace corruption to gain tremendous psychic might. They channel the raw energy of the warp with little concern for the consequences.

Their powers manifest as chaotic, fiery energy mixed with warp distortions, reflecting their unstable connection to the Immaterium.
